It starts with an initial short and interactive session. This session allows participants to better understand their own company leadership framework and competencies and how they can be integrated with The Leadership Company methodology. It highlights understanding of an individual’s own leadership skills and helps create a personal flexible approach to learning.
Participants work in small groups and are taken through a series of tasks. These involve a unique mix of time pressured practical and mental project planning activities. Tasks reflect the real work environment enabling participants to experience making mistakes and adapting, to gain accelerated learning in a safe but realistic environment. Most importantly, each task is followed by an intense and constructive debrief using our unique ‘Just 5 words’ process. The focus of our debriefs being how to analyse the team and leadership dynamics from that task. Along with the importance of receiving feedback constructively and how to improve performance going forward.
This is the first stage to understanding performance dynamics and leadership approaches within a team and what value they can bring to that process. Moving to a ‘Change’ agenda is where the teams begin to understand how a high performance team meets the challenges in a changing environment.
This element is designed to stretch participants and highlight their development and understanding of leadership and delivery.
More complex, time pressured tasks mirror closely the transition from delivering results in small workplace teams to leading projects or change across multi-departmental teams and organisations. The pace and complexity of these tasks will be varied depending on the level of the participants and organisational requirements.
Teams will experience the impact of adapting and challenges faced when leading through change.
Each participant will review their personal feedback from the start of the programme and their progression through each session. Action plans for further development form the basis of an individual’s personal action plan for ongoing development. Including identification of strengths and areas where further development is required to better maximise leadership effectiveness. A company’s values or leadership framework are usually also weaved into this session to ensure a holistic view and understanding of capabilities and where each participant sits.
The, most importantly, the focus is on how personal development can be most effectively transferred back to the workplace. Each participant will identify key areas that they personally will do differently when they return to work. Feedback can be integrated into an organisations existing personal development plans, used as personal standalone targets or linked to future Leadership Company programmes.
